Definitions
Noun
- 1 A highly skilled and dedicated manager. informal
- 2 A highly paid corporate executive.
"In all the English-speaking countries, the primary reason for increased income inequality in recent decades is the rise of the supermanager in both the financial and nonfinancial sectors."

Etymology
From super- + manager.
